How to Choose the Best Toilet Seat Riser

Selecting the right toilet seat riser involves understanding your specific needs, toilet type, and physical requirements. This buying guide walks you through each consideration so you can make an informed decision.

Height Selection

The most important factor in choosing a riser is getting the right height increase. Measure from your floor to the back of your knee while standing with your foot flat on the floor and knee bent at 90 degrees. Subtract your current toilet seat height from this measurement to find how much additional height you need.

Most users need between 3 and 5 inches of height increase. If you have a comfort height toilet (which is already taller than standard), you may only need 2 to 3 inches. Forum users recovering from hip replacement surgery frequently mentioned starting with a higher riser and switching to a lower one as their recovery progressed.

Round vs Elongated Compatibility

To determine your toilet shape, measure the length of the bowl opening. Round toilets are typically 16 to 18 inches long, while elongated bowls are 18 to 20 inches long. Some risers fit both shapes, while others work only with round or only with elongated toilets.

Mismatch between your toilet shape and riser design can cause instability, poor fit, and safety concerns. Always verify compatibility before purchasing. Several products in this guide offer both round and elongated versions, which simplifies selection.

Weight Capacity

Standard risers typically support 250 to 300 pounds. If you or your user weighs more, look for heavy-duty models that support 400 pounds or more. Exceeding the weight capacity creates safety risks and may damage the product or your toilet.

Consider not just current weight but potential future needs. Users recovering from surgery may gain weight due to reduced activity during recovery. Choosing a higher-capacity model provides a margin of safety.

Handles and Armrests

Handles provide crucial support for users with balance issues, lower body weakness, or conditions like arthritis that affect sitting and standing. They are not optional for users who need upper body support to get up from the toilet.

Removable handles offer flexibility for households where different users have different needs. Padded handles provide more comfort than bare metal or plastic. Consider handle width and spacing to ensure comfortable use.

Installation Type

Bolt-on risers provide the most stable connection but require removing your existing seat and permanently modifying the toilet. Clamp-on risers sit on the bowl and clamp in place without tools, making them portable but potentially less stable. Floor-standing models provide maximum adjustability but take up bathroom space and create trip hazards.

For permanent daily use by a single user, bolt-on models like the Lunderg provide the best stability. For temporary use or rental situations, clamp-on or floor-standing models work better. Consider how long you will need the riser when choosing an installation type.

Stability and Safety

Stability goes beyond weight capacity. Look for features like anti-slip pads, interior lips that prevent forward movement, and secure locking mechanisms. Read user reviews specifically for stability feedback, as some designs that seem secure in theory perform poorly in real-world use.

Physical therapists consulted for this guide emphasized that stability is more important than height. A lower riser that stays firmly in place is safer than a higher riser that shifts during use. Consider combining a basic riser with grab bars elsewhere in the bathroom for comprehensive safety.

Cleaning and Maintenance

Hygiene matters in the bathroom, and some riser designs clean more easily than others. Removable seats like those on the Loyoda and Lunderg models allow thorough cleaning underneath. Smooth surfaces without crevices clean faster than textured or multi-piece designs.

Antimicrobial protection, like the Microban feature on the Medline riser, provides ongoing protection between cleanings. This matters particularly for users with compromised immune systems or those sharing bathrooms with multiple people.

Medicare and Medicaid Coverage

Some toilet seat risers may be covered by Medicare Part B or Medicaid as durable medical equipment (DME) when prescribed by a doctor for medical necessity. The process typically requires a doctor’s prescription and documentation of medical need.

FSA (Flexible Spending Account) and HSA (Health Savings Account) funds can be used for toilet seat risers without a prescription in most cases. Products marked as FSA/HSA eligible in this guide can be purchased using these pre-tax dollars, providing real savings.

Are toilet seat risers safe?

Yes, toilet seat risers are safe when properly installed and used as designed. Bolt-on models provide the most secure attachment, while clamp-on models require smooth bowl surfaces for stable grip. Users with balance issues should choose models with handles for added support. Following installation instructions carefully and checking stability before each use ensures safe operation.

What is the best height for a toilet seat for the elderly?

The ideal height depends on the user’s height and the existing toilet height. Most elderly users benefit from a riser that adds 3 to 5 inches to the existing seat. For standard toilets (15 inches from floor to seat), a 4 to 5 inch riser works well. For comfort height toilets (17 inches or taller), a 2 to 3 inch riser may be sufficient. Measure the user’s knee height and subtract current seat height to find the optimal increase.

What are the alternatives to a toilet seat riser?

Alternatives to toilet seat risers include raised toilet seats that replace the entire seat, toilet safety rails that provide support without raising the seat, transfer benches for shower and toilet combination areas, commode chairs that can be placed over the toilet, and bidet seats with integrated raising features. For users with severe mobility limitations, a combination of a riser with additional grab bars provides the best support.
